#hotp #totp #otp

otp2

提供HOTP和TOTP的一次性密码实现

1 个不稳定版本

0.0.1 2023年7月5日

#hotp 中排名 27

MIT 许可证

11KB
213 代码行

基于HMAC的一次性密码

提供IETF RFCs的两种实现

  • 4226: 简单递增计数器(HOTP)
  • 6238: 基于时间的计数器(TOTP)

可以通过实现ToBytes trait来提供自定义基于HMAC的一次性密码。

依赖项

~1.5–2.2MB
~49K SLoC